    A beautiful city with lots to see and places to visit.

    A beautiful city with lots to see and places to visit. Safe walking in the streets even on the large avenues, drivers are very careful with the pedestrians. Public transport not very easy to use. It's a walkable city and taxis are not expensive for longer distances. A Danube night cruise is definitely a must!!! Remember lights on buldings go off at 10:30pm. Parliament in the night is magical. Buda site also a must and do get the small hop on hop off blue bus. It takes you to all sights and you do't miss a thing.

    Linz is an industrial and admin centre on the (definitely...

    Linz is an industrial and admin centre on the (definitely not blue) Danube river . Small airport with (as at July 2025) 2 flights a week from London STN. Pedestrianised town centre with a mix of old and new architecture gives no clue that the pleasant clean town has an active steel works. No special tourist draw but a reasonable base for touring and onward travel, Large Danube cruise ships stop at Linz but most passengers are sent to Salzburg by coach and make minimal contribution to the Linz economy.
